Chapter 3 - Polynomial and Rational Functions - Exercise Set 3.7 - Page 430: 17

Answer

$x=kz(y+w)$ $y=\displaystyle \frac{x}{kz}-w$

Work Step by Step

$x$ varies directly as $z:\qquad x=kz$ $x$ varies directly as $(y+w):\qquad x=k(y+w)$ Combined (jointly): $\qquad x=kz(y+w)$ Solving for $y,$ $x=kz(y+w)\qquad/\div kz$ $\displaystyle \frac{x}{kz}=y+w\qquad/-w$ $y=\displaystyle \frac{x}{kz}-w$
